Transaction 068d5e3f611976dc582de6655aa18dcf225a49e730b27f32c1a974159c211eec

1 Input
2 Outputs
  • 068d5e3f611976dc582de6655aa18dcf225a49e730b27f32c1a974159c211eec:0
  • value  2239983
    address  3E4iDKSw9feUMCaUcwHPEwJAM9ySDmkx2b
  • 068d5e3f611976dc582de6655aa18dcf225a49e730b27f32c1a974159c211eec:1
  • value  91820397
    address  3PGXHd4g2rn1KCzSGzs6aGKsGjsFnuoSY9